Re: usbkbd.c error: led urb status -32 received
On Sun, Apr 21, 2002 at 08:01:55PM -0700, Chris Tillman wrote:
> I keep getting this error whenever I hit my caps lock key, num lock,
> or now when I use Command-left and -right arrow to change virtual
> consoles (this is a powerpc iMac with 2.4.16-newpmac kernel). I
> have the standard iMac keyboard which is a USB keyboard, and I have
> the mac-usb-us keymap selected with Linux keycodes in place.
>
> This is a 'spam' kind of message that appears in every console
> simultaneously, no matter what application is running.
>
> Does anyone know what I have done wrong to be getting this? BTW, AFAIK
> the only LED on my keyboard is inside the Caps Lock key, and it doesn't
> seem to work when this is taking place.
>
It seems to be fixed, I installed any likely sounding modules I could
find for USB and the keyboard. I think the hid module was the one that
cured it (because I now see in dmesg usbkbd.c: USB HID boot protocol).
